Techniques for building robust incremental sampling strategies for continuous monitoring of dataset quality and distribution shifts.
A practical exploration of incremental sampling methods, adaptive plan design, and metrics that safeguard dataset integrity while detecting subtle shifts in distribution over time.
Published July 29, 2025
Facebook X Reddit Pinterest Email
In modern data workflows, incremental sampling emerges as a pragmatic approach to maintain up‑to‑date insights without resampling entire archives. The core idea is to build a sampling mechanism that evolves alongside the data it observes, adjusting its composition as new records arrive and old ones age. This strategy reduces computational burden while preserving statistical value, enabling teams to monitor quality indicators and distributional properties continuously. By designing sampling units that reflect practical constraints—such as storage limits, update frequency, and latency requirements—organizations can foster faster feedback loops. The result is a resilient foundation for detecting drift, anomalies, and data quality issues before they impact downstream models and decisions.
A robust incremental sampling framework begins with a clear definition of what constitutes representativeness in the target domain. Stakeholders should articulate key quality metrics, such as missingness patterns, feature distributions, and label integrity, and tie these to sampling rules. The sampling process then becomes a dynamic contract: it specifies when to refresh the sample, how much historical context to retain, and which strata or cohorts deserve higher attention. By codifying these decisions, teams avoid ad hoc changes that destabilize monitoring. In practice, a well‑designed system balances fresh observations with historical continuity, ensuring that changes in data streams are captured without overwhelming the analysis with noise.
Keeping the sample relevant through ongoing validation and checks.
Effective incremental sampling hinges on stratification that mirrors the data population while allowing for adaptive reweighting. Stratified sampling can preserve important subpopulations, ensuring that shifts in rare but consequential segments remain visible. Yet as distributions evolve, static strata may become misaligned with reality. A robust approach couples stratification with dynamic reweighting, so that the importance of each stratum can rise or fall proportionally to its current impact on model performance or quality metrics. Additionally, maintaining a rolling window for recent observations helps the system stay sensitive to abrupt changes while preventing legacy data from obscuring genuine drift signals. The design should remain transparent, auditable, and easy to adjust as needs evolve.
ADVERTISEMENT
ADVERTISEMENT
Beyond stratification, incremental sampling benefits from incorporating reservoir concepts and bias‑aware selection. Reservoir sampling ensures a fair chance for new observations to enter the sample, even when the total population size is unknown or unbounded. Bias awareness requires monitoring selection probabilities and correcting for systematic preferences that might creep into the sampling process. Combining these ideas with constraints like memory limits or processing time keeps the system scalable. Practitioners can implement periodic audits that compare the sampled window to the full data stream, quantifying divergence and triggering schedule adjustments if drift accelerates. The objective is to sustain a representative, manageable view of the data landscape over time.
Monitoring distribution shifts with lightweight, scalable diagnostics.
A crucial component of incremental sampling is continuous validation against independent benchmarks. When possible, teams should run parallel, lightweight validators that contrast the sample against a gold standard or holdout partitions. The validators can track distributional distances, feature correlations, and integrity checks for labels or timestamps. When discrepancies exceed predefined tolerances, the sampling mechanism can react by widening the window, increasing the weight of underrepresented regions, or refreshing strata definitions. This feedback loop ensures that the sampler remains aligned with real data dynamics, reinforcing trust in analytics outputs and reducing the risk of stale or biased perspectives guiding decisions.
ADVERTISEMENT
ADVERTISEMENT
Another dimension is the integration of domain knowledge into sampling rules. Subject matter insights help identify which features or cohorts warrant tighter monitoring due to business impact or regulatory relevance. For example, customer segments experiencing policy changes or known data ingestion bottlenecks deserve amplified scrutiny. By embedding these insights into the sampling policy, teams can prioritize resource allocation where it matters most. The challenge lies in balancing expert judgments with empirical evidence; combined they yield a strategy that captures meaningful shifts without getting distracted by transient noise. Iterative refinement, guided by metrics and governance standards, keeps the sampling system healthy over time.
Practical engineering patterns for incremental sampling at scale.
Lightweight diagnostics are essential to scale incremental sampling across large data ecosystems. Rather than performing heavy statistical tests on every update, practitioners implement monitoring signals that aggregate essential indicators. Population stability indices, Kullback–Leibler divergences, and feature distribution plots can be calculated on rolling baselines to reveal deviations. These diagnostics should support actionable thresholds rather than punitive alarms, guiding when to adjust sampling parameters rather than triggering full rework. The emphasis is on early, interpretable signals that pair with automatic governance rules, such as auto‑tuning window sizes or reweighting schemes. When properly tuned, diagnostics empower teams to act decisively while maintaining operational efficiency.
Distributed data environments demand careful coordination of sampling across nodes or regions. Consistency guarantees—such as synchronized clocks, unified schemas, and coordinated refresh cadences—prevent divergent views of the data from eroding trust. A practical approach uses centralized configuration with local adapters that respect regional latency and privacy constraints. Audit trails should capture changes to sampling strategies, dates of refreshes, and reasons for adaptation. By keeping observability high, organizations can diagnose drift sources quickly, whether they originate from ingestion pipelines, feature engineering steps, or downstream consumption layers. Over time, this coherence underpins robust monitoring that remains effective as the dataset grows and evolves.
ADVERTISEMENT
ADVERTISEMENT
From experimentation to governance in continuous monitoring.
Implementing incremental sampling at scale benefits from modular, pluggable components. A typical architecture includes a sampler core, strata managers, validator hooks, and governance controls. The core handles record eligibility and update rules; strata managers maintain population segments; validators perform lightweight checks; governance enforces compliance and safety constraints. This modularity enables teams to swap algorithms, calibrate thresholds, or experiment with alternative weighting strategies without destabilizing the entire system. Operational resilience comes from clear error handling, idempotent refresh processes, and robust retries during ingestion hiccups. The result is a flexible framework that adapts to changing data landscapes while preserving a stable monitoring signal.
Automation and observability are the twin engines of durable incremental sampling. Automated rollouts of sampling policy changes must be accompanied by rich telemetry: versioned configurations, performance metrics, drift alerts, and user‑visible dashboards. Observability helps quantify the impact of adjustments, showing how sample quality, coverage, and drift detection respond to each iteration. Teams should institutionalize post‑deployment reviews to assess unintended consequences and to recalibrate thresholds. Over time, automation coupled with transparent instrumentation reduces manual toil, accelerates experimentation, and sustains confidence in data quality over long horizons.
Governance plays a pivotal role in ensuring that incremental sampling remains principled and compliant. Clear documentation of rules, assumptions, and validation criteria helps auditors verify that sampling strategies adhere to internal standards and external regulations. Access controls and provenance tracking ensure accountability for changes to configurations and data views. Regular reviews between data engineers, data scientists, and business stakeholders foster shared understanding of drift signals and sampling choices. By embedding governance into the lifecycle, organizations avoid drift in policy itself and maintain a durable baseline for monitoring across versions and deployments.
Finally, evergreen practices emphasize learning and adaptation. As datasets mature, teams revisit objectives, update quality metrics, and refine sampling heuristics to reflect new realities. This iterative mindset keeps the approach relevant, avoiding stagnation even as technologies and data sources evolve. Practical guidance includes maintaining a backlog of potential sampling improvements, running controlled experiments on policy tweaks, and documenting outcomes for institutional memory. The enduring goal is a sampling strategy that remains effective under shifting distributions, supports timely decisions, and scales gracefully with data growth, without compromising integrity or trust.
Related Articles
Data engineering
A practical, evergreen guide on building partner data feeds that balance privacy, efficiency, and usefulness through systematic curation, thoughtful governance, and scalable engineering practices.
-
July 30, 2025
Data engineering
This evergreen guide explores scalable strategies for incremental data workloads, emphasizing partition-level checkpointing, fault-tolerant recovery, and parallel recomputation to accelerate processing while preserving accuracy and efficiency.
-
July 18, 2025
Data engineering
This evergreen guide explores consistent methods to quantify data processing emissions, evaluates lifecycle impacts of pipelines, and outlines practical strategies for reducing energy use while preserving performance and reliability.
-
July 21, 2025
Data engineering
This evergreen guide explains how to design differential privacy pipelines that allow robust aggregate analytics while protecting individual privacy, addressing practical challenges, governance concerns, and scalable implementations across modern data systems.
-
August 03, 2025
Data engineering
A practical guide to building scalable training and documentation initiatives that boost platform adoption, cut repetitive inquiries, and empower teams to leverage data engineering tools with confidence and consistency.
-
July 18, 2025
Data engineering
A comprehensive guide to forming cross-functional data retirement committees, outlining governance, risk assessment, and transparent stakeholder communication strategies essential for sustainable data lifecycle management.
-
July 17, 2025
Data engineering
A practical, evergreen guide exploring how distributed query systems can lower tail latency by optimizing resource allocation, slicing queries intelligently, prioritizing critical paths, and aligning workloads with system capacity.
-
July 16, 2025
Data engineering
Timezone consistency is essential across data pipelines to prevent drift, misalignment, and erroneous analytics; disciplined practices, standardization, and automated validation help maintain uniform offsets and trusted temporal accuracy throughout ingestion, processing, and delivery stages.
-
August 07, 2025
Data engineering
This evergreen guide outlines durable strategies for crafting dataset APIs that remain stable while accommodating evolving downstream needs, ensuring backward compatibility, predictable migrations, and smooth collaboration across teams and platforms over time.
-
July 29, 2025
Data engineering
A practical, evergreen guide to creating a universal labeling framework that consistently communicates data sensitivity, informs automated protection policies, and enables reliable, scalable reviews across diverse data ecosystems.
-
August 08, 2025
Data engineering
A practical, evergreen guide to designing robust, maintainable experiment logs that connect feature iterations with data versions and measurable model outcomes for reliable, repeatable machine learning engineering.
-
August 10, 2025
Data engineering
A practical, mindset-shifting guide for engineering teams to establish consistent error handling. Structured patterns reduce debugging toil, accelerate recovery, and enable clearer operational visibility across data transformation pipelines.
-
July 30, 2025
Data engineering
Semantic search and recommendations demand scalable vector similarity systems; this article explores practical optimization strategies, from indexing and quantization to hybrid retrieval, caching, and operational best practices for robust performance.
-
August 11, 2025
Data engineering
This evergreen guide examines practical methods to merge data lineage with rich annotations, enabling transparent datasets that satisfy auditors, regulators, and stakeholders while preserving data utility and governance compliance.
-
August 05, 2025
Data engineering
This evergreen guide outlines practical maturity indicators shaping a transparent, scalable pathway for datasets as they move from experimental proofs of concept to robust, production-ready assets powering reliable analytics and decision making.
-
August 03, 2025
Data engineering
Organizations seeking faster analytics must rethink where transformations occur, shifting work toward the data warehouse while keeping data quality high, scalable, and auditable across complex integration scenarios in real time.
-
July 26, 2025
Data engineering
A practical guide to reducing data collection, retaining essential attributes, and aligning storage with both business outcomes and regulatory requirements through thoughtful governance, instrumentation, and policy.
-
July 19, 2025
Data engineering
In modern data architectures, automation enables continuous reconciliation between source-of-truth systems and analytical copies, helping teams detect drift early, enforce consistency, and maintain trust across data products through scalable, repeatable processes.
-
July 14, 2025
Data engineering
Reproducible analytics demand disciplined practices that capture the computational environment, versioned code, and data lineage, enabling others to rebuild experiments precisely, verify results, and extend insights without reinventing the wheel.
-
July 19, 2025
Data engineering
This evergreen guide explores reliable methods for allocating data platform costs to teams, using consumption signals, governance practices, and transparent accounting to ensure fairness, accountability, and sustainable usage across the organization.
-
August 08, 2025